Three subways to be renovated soon.
Three pedestrian subways on Anna Salai will soon be given a facelift. The Highways Department has called for tenders from contractors to renovate subways near Anna Flyover (Safire theatre), Thousand Lights Mosque and Guindy. The interiors would be checked for leaks, cracks and broken steps would be repaired. These apart, lighting would be improved inside, explained a source in the Highways Department, which maintains these facilities.
“Only the usual cleaning is done on a regular basis. Renovation has not been taken up in quite sometime. The entrances to these subways too would be changed and each of them would have a different look so that they can be individually identified,” the official explained.
Earlier, the department had embarked upon an idea to have identical looking subways, which is why those near Simpsons and Head Post office on Anna Salai have similar fan-like openings on top. But this idea seems to have been shown the door, recalled a town planner. A total of ₹3.5 crore has been earmarked for the renovation of subways. “The Guindy subway is so busy and witnesses heavy footfalls. The department should ensure that it is cleaned on a regular basis,” said K. Murugan, who works in the Guindy industrial estate.
